【程序员必备】Git的使用方法(持续更新中)

Git的使用方法

作者:Adlerain

1. 安装git

1.1 下载地址

git-scm.com/download/wi...

1.2 安装

之前写的有缺陷

github安装教程

安装成功

注:如果不用自定义的话一直下一步

2. 代码上传git

2.1 新仓库

bash 复制代码
git init 
git add .
git commit -m "first commit"
git remote add origin 仓库链接
git push -u origin "master"

2.2 已有仓库

新的变更

bash 复制代码
git add .
git commit -m "first commit"
git remote add origin 仓库链接
git push origin "master"

2.3 分支上传

bash 复制代码
git remote add origin 仓库名称  //链接仓库

git checkout -b 22ji2  //创建分支

git add .

git commit -m "first commit"

git remote add origin 仓库链接

git push -u origin "22ji2" 

git branch   //查看本地分支

git branch -a   //查看远程分支

2.4 从远程仓库拉取变更

bash 复制代码
git pull origin 分支名

2.5 解决冲突

当本地变更与远程变更冲突时,Git 无法自动合并变更。此时,我们需要手动解决冲突。冲突通常发生在同一文件的相同行或相邻行上,Git 会在发生冲突的位置标记出冲突的内容:

Bash 复制代码
<<<<<<< HEAD
本地变更
=======
远程变更
>>>>>>> branch-name

<<<<<<< HEAD======= 之间是本地的变更

=======>>>>>>> branch-name 之间是远程的变更

需要手动选择保留哪个版本的变更,或者进行进一步的编辑来解决冲突。

解决完冲突后,使用以下命令将解决后的变更提交到本地 Git 仓库:

bash 复制代码
$ git add 文件名
$ git commit -m "解决冲突"

然后,可以使用之前介绍的推送命令将解决后的变更推送到远程仓库。

2.6分支管理

分支是 Git 强大功能之一,它可以帮助我们在不影响主线开发的情况下,进行新特性的开发或 bug 修复

  • 创建新分支:git branch 分支名
  • 切换到分支:git checkout 分支名
  • 创建并切换到新分支:git checkout -b 分支名
  • 删除分支:git branch -d 分支名
  • 查看分支:git branch

在团队协作开发中,每个开发人员可以在自己的分支上独立工作,完成后再将变更合并到主线分支或其他分支上。这样可以有效避免直接在主线上修改代码可能带来的冲突和问题。

相关推荐
sunny_liangzilong3 小时前
为何 git 默认是 master分支,而github默认是main分支(DeepSeek问答)
git·github
yangshuo12814 小时前
git安装flutter
git·flutter
16年上任的CTO5 小时前
git基础使用--4---git分支和使用
git·gitee·git分支
16年上任的CTO5 小时前
git基础使用--1--版本控制的基本概念
git·gitee·版本控制
wdxylb8 小时前
GIt使用笔记大全
笔记·git·elasticsearch
maply20 小时前
VSCode 中的 Git Graph扩展使用详解
ide·git·vscode·编辑器·扩展
行十万里人生1 天前
Qt事件处理:理解处理器、过滤器与事件系统
开发语言·git·qt·华为od·华为·华为云·harmonyos
会敲代码的Steve1 天前
git笔记-简单入门
笔记·git
画船听雨眠aa1 天前
gitlab云服务器配置
服务器·git·elasticsearch·gitlab
Tangcan-2 天前
Linux中基础开发工具(yum,vim,gcc/g++,git,gdb/cgdb)
linux·git·vim